Address 0 PPC

PCUrxVuYUSsb7RfngrUpQ9JzBdVSpTtQfE

Confirmed

Total Received75.852996 PPC
Total Sent75.852996 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CUrxVuYUSsb7RfngrUpQ9JzBdVSpTtQfE75.852996 PPC
Fee: 0.01 PPC
610207 Confirmations75.842996 PPC
PCUrxVuYUSsb7RfngrUpQ9JzBdVSpTtQfE75.852996 PPC
PWeGzk96QTcYsPSnZfBhz5aHJBPxAsqb2N0.68975 PPC
Fee: 0.01 PPC
610219 Confirmations76.542746 PPC